## Break-Glass Access: Fabrikette Test-Data Factory

If the Fabrikette seed vault becomes unreachable, contractors may invoke break-glass mode to regenerate fixture datasets locally. Use this only after confirming the outage with the on-call steward, and log every invocation in the incident channel. The recovery passphrase required to unlock the offline seed bundle is below.

unlock words, kagef-taduf: fenir-quenix-norwyn-sorvan-gormir-gorir-fraok

## Step 4: Cursor pagination

Offset pagination is removed in Lattix API v3. All list endpoints now return a cursor token; pass it back verbatim. Page size caps at 200. Clients still sending offset params get a 400 as of next Thursday. Defaults shipping with the v3 gateway are as follows.

config for kafof-bawef:
holath:
  log_level: debug
  metrics_host: metrics.holath.qorvelsys.internal
  pin: 2191
  pool_size: 32

# Heads up, on-call friends: this file controls the circuit breaker for the
# Quistrel upstream API. When Quistrel starts timing out (it does, usually
# around their Tuesday deploys), the breaker trips after 5 consecutive
# failures and holds open for 30 seconds. Don't crank the thresholds up just
# to silence pages — fix the retry budget instead. The half-open probe uses
# a single request, so spikes right after recovery are normal. The breaker's
# admin endpoint authenticates with a shared token, set on the next line.

secret setting of hawep-yahig: LEDGER_TOKEN29=41b5d6315371c92885eaeb077fb63